Yeah, in a market economy if they all started dropping prices it would just be a race to the bottom, which is good for some tenants but will probably result in less repairs and could lead to some properties going bankrupt and being bought out by larger companies.
The real value in these properties is equity, as in how much profit they will be able to realize upon sale, while the continued operations up to that point are a budgetary tightrope walk.
